Southern All Stars 2017 Recap

FAYETTEVILLE, TN- The Southern All Star Dirt Racing Series will kick off its 35th consecutive year of dirt late model racing in the southeast and the series had a few first time accomplishments happen in 2017.

First Austin Horton of Newnan, GA., ran his first full year with the series and became the first driver to win the series title as well as the Cruise with the Champions/Dirtondirt.com Rookie of the Year. Horton did not have a win in 2017 but in the 15 races race Austin had 7 top five finishes and 10 top ten finishes, with his best finish a second place at his home track Senoia Raceway. Look for Austin to be back in 2018 to compete for the title again.

Tristan Sealy of Moultrie, GA., was also in his first full year with the series and went to tracks that he had never seen but kept improving and finished second in the series points with one top five finish and that occurred at Senoia. Tristan also had 5 top finishes during the 2017 season. Tristan plans on return to the series in 2017 and making a run for the title.
Eric Hickerson of Linden, TN., was another rookie contender in 2017. Eric was also in his first full year of tour racing and captured the AR Bodies Challenge with the series in 2017, finished third in series points, his best finish was third at his home track Thunderhill Raceway, and Eric also had 9 top ten finishes during the year. Eric plans on competing with the series in 2018.

T J Reaid of Acworth, GA., finished fourth in also his first full year with the series as he got his first series win at the Talladega Short Track in the season finale. T J also had two top 5 finishes and six top10 finishes. Also T J joins his dad Tony on the all-time winners list for Southern All Stars as they are the first father son duo to win Southern All Stars races. His father Tony won two Southern All Star events at Dixie Speedway during the 1991 season.

Brad Skinner of Spring Hill, TN., came in the first spot in his second ear of tour racing. Brad had to miss a few races early in the season as he flipped his car and had to wait on a new one and missed a few races. Brad had one win in 2017 and that was at his home track Thunderhill. Brad also had two top 5?s and four top 10?s Brad also finished second in the AR Bodies Challenge. Brad also plans on competing for the series title in 2018.

In 2017 the Southern All Stars ran 15 events at 8 different tracks and 200 different drivers competing with the series. Drivers that scored wins also on the series were Casey Roberts of Toccoa, GA., with three wins Southern Raceway & Cochran Motor Speedway, four time Southern All Stars Champion Clint Smith back in victory lane for first time since 2009 at Senoia, Dane Dacus of Lakeland, TN., Thunderhill, Jason Hiett of Oxford, AL., Talladega Short Track, Brandon Overton of Evans, GA., Talladega Short Track, David Breazeale of Four Corners, MS., Thunderhill, Donald McIntosh of Blairsville, GA., Smoky Mt, Ross Bailes of Clover, SC., Cherokee and Brandon Sheppard of New Berlin, IL., Smoky Mt.

The 2018 schedule should be ready for release next week with the season opener right now set for Sunday March 4th March Madness at Cherokee Speedway in Gaffney, SC., and will pay $12,000 to win.

2017 SOUTHERN ALL STAR POINTS STANDINGS: 1.Austin Horton 1090; 2.Tristan Sealy 962; 3.Eric Hickerson 936; 4. T J Reaid 816; 5.Brad Skinner 764; 6.Bo Shirley 466; 7.Casey Roberts 458; 8.Riley Hickman 418; 9.Clint Smith 402; 10.Josh Putnam 376;

2017 CRUISE WITH THE CHAMPIONS/DIRTONDIRT.COM ROOKIE OF THE YEAR: 1.Austin Horton 1090; 2.Tristan Sealy 962; 3. Eric Hickerson 936; 4.T J Reaid 816

2017 AR Bodies Challenge: 1.Eric Hickerson 346; 2.Brad Skinner 263; 3.Josh Putnam 132; 4.Todd Morrow 123; 5.Brandon Overton 106; 6.Joseph Faulkner 58 7.Jason Walker 50; 8.Derek Ellis 35; 9.Mitch Thornton 35; 10.Jamie Perry 33; 11.Jeff Johns 30; 12.Jason Lyles 24; 13.David Brannon 19; 14.Ferrell Skelton 17; 15.Dean Carpenter 16; 15.John Minon 15; 17.Jim Gray 15
